Remarks

I am form poor family My father income is not so much that's why I take admission in this college I use to do side job after the college and form those money I give my college fees But I am not satisfied with this college facilities. Very bad sports facilities lack of resources

Course Curriculum Overview

average curriculum, academic, and faculties in my college Only vollyball and boxing are good in this college some teachers straf is also good teaching skills But some are very bad aur office staff aur admission section staff is very rude and don't know how to talk

Placement Experience

1

There will be no company visited And no one get placement in any company after graduate None of my batch mate get placement in any company

College Events

1.5

Very boring life in the campus there is nothing to do in free period No canteen no festival were celebrated by the college no cultural program were celebrated very bad freshers party and costly students get bored all time time

Campus Life

Infrastructure for some sports are good like vollyball boxing bedminton But not much options in sports, cricket ground is not so good No football ground Indoor sports facilities are so bad Library is not bigger, old books new books are very few not much space for students, every few students were entered at a time Lab equipment are also broken aur old new facility aur equipment are not there

Government MAM College, Bachelor of Arts [BA]
Reviewed on Oct 9, 2024(Enrolled 2023)

Course Curriculum Overview:

I had chosen the course myself but this year due to NEP we had 7 subjects which is kinda difficult for us to study .only 2 subject are main that are major and minor rest changes as per semester, so last year my multidisciplinary subject was Geography in 1st sem and then Geology in 2nd semester. There must be some changes in course. 1. Shortage must not be 75% it becomes difficult for students . 2. Teaching method must have to be improved.. Colleges have a semester of 6 months, they give information in 1 to 2 months and after some time in the semester, papers start..they should give some more time for preparation. The difficultly level of exams are not much... kinda easy paper . In minor exams the time limit is one hour and in major 2.5 hour . Sometimes time is problem too ... As I'm humanities student and we hv to write in length but sometimes due to time shortage weren't able to write much contents but overall my experience in college was good
